South Carolina teenage drivers in danger of deadly summer accidents

Attention South Carolina motorists! Teenage drivers pose a deadly risk on the road during the summer. Between Memorial Day and Labor Day, more deadly auto accidents involving teenage drivers happen than any other time of year, according to a recent auto accident study by AAA. Specifically, nearly 15 teenagers between 13 and 19 years old were killed every day nationwide between Memorial Day and Labor Day in car accidents between 2005 and 2009, reports AAA. That’s more than 7,300 teenagers!

Why the increase in motorcycle accidents? Experts have cited the recent rise in the number of motorcycles on the road. In 1998, there were 3.8 million motorcycles on the road. By 2008, that number had skyrocketed to 7.7 million motorcycles.  But there may be another reason for this increase. During the same time period, many states relaxed their motorcycle helmet laws.

Helmets drastically reduce the likelihood of dying in a motorcycle accident. Riders wearing helmets are 37 percent less likely to die in a crash than riders without helmets, according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ration. That’s why many states still require motorcyclists to wear helmets. In South Carolina, motorcyclists 20 years old and younger are required by law to wear helmets.
